University of Idaho

Idaho's best public online university, the University of Idaho offers seven online undergraduate and three online graduate degrees, including popular bachelor's programs in history and organizational sciences. All bachelor's programs accept significant transfer credit, making them an attractive option for prospective students who already possess an associate degree. Available master's programs prepare graduates for careers as public administrators, psychologists, and performing artists. Prospective students can review the U of I website to explore careers and learn more about available internship opportunities. Students may also explore the four-year degree plan for each program, an excellent tool that helps learners graduate on time. All degree-seekers meet with an advisor at least once per term, typically before registering for courses. U of I accepts new students in the fall semester, and undergraduate application requirements include ACT or SAT scores. Application materials for graduate applicants vary by program. In-state learners may qualify for up to $4,000 per year in automatic merit-based scholarships; these awards stack with other institutional aid.
